The Rise of Solar Innovation in Urban Infrastructure
Urban centres face increasing pressure to reduce carbon footprints while maintaining safety and aesthetic appeal. Solar lighting addresses these challenges efficiently, offering self-sufficient systems that operate independently of grid electricity. These solutions incorporate advancements such as smart controls, energy storage, and adaptive lighting, ensuring optimal performance across diverse settings.
Recent industry reports indicate that the global solar lighting market is projected to grow at a compound annual rate of over 20% through 2030, driven by government incentives, decreasing costs of photovoltaic (PV) technology, and public demand for sustainable infrastructure. Notably, cities like London, Manchester, and Birmingham are implementing solar street lighting, harnessing the sun’s power to illuminate public spaces without incurring extensive operational costs.
Innovative Features Driving Adoption
| Feature | Description | Benefits |
|---|---|---|
| Integrated Photovoltaic Modules | Embedded PV panels capture solar energy during daylight hours. | Self-sustaining operation with minimal maintenance. |
| Intelligent Sensors | Light sensors and motion detectors modulate brightness based on activity. | Enhanced energy efficiency and prolonged system lifespan. |
| Energy Storage Systems | High-capacity batteries store excess solar energy for night-time use. | Consistent illumination regardless of weather conditions. |
| Remote Monitoring & Control | Wireless connectivity enables real-time system management. | Operational transparency and proactive maintenance. |
Case Studies: Sustainable Lighting in Practice
For example, in urban redevelopment projects, solar lighting units have been installed along cycle paths and pedestrian zones, significantly reducing energy costs and lowering carbon emissions. A notable case is the deployment of solar-powered streetlights in Manchester’s Spinningfields area, which reports over 80% savings on electricity bills since installation.

Future Trends in Solar Lighting Innovation
- OLED Solar Panels: Ultralight, flexible PV materials integrated into urban fixtures.
- AI-Driven Lighting Management: Adaptive systems enhancing energy savings and user experience.
- Hybrid Systems: Combining solar with other renewable sources for enhanced reliability.
As technological advancements continue, solar lighting will likely become an integral component of smarter, greener cities, aligning urban development with climate resilience goals.
